![]() In case you have more than one entry file, let's say index.html and about.html, you have 2 ways to run the bundler: ![]() ![]() You can use this tool for learning how to set up a new project and you can also download the project as a ZIP-file and get started coding instantly. Select the features you need such as React, Vue, Typescript and CSS, and you will see the project being generated in real-time. You can also use v to create a Parcel project in the browser. This still automatically rebuilds as files change and supports hot module replacement, but doesn't start a web server. If you do have your own server, you can run Parcel in watch mode instead. Use the development server when you don't have your own server, or your app is entirely client rendered. You can also override the default port with the -p option. If hot module replacement isn't working you may need to configure your editor. Point it at your entry file: parcel index.html Parcel has a development server built in, which will automatically rebuild your app as you change files and supports hot module replacement for fast development. NB: Parcel converts JS assets to ES5, which won't run in in the context of a tag, so just use plain tags with no type attribute in your source HTML. Next, create an index.html and index.js file. If you link your main JavaScript file in the HTML using a relative path, Parcel will also process it for you, and replace the reference with a URL to the output file. Parcel can take any type of file as an entry point, but an HTML or JavaScript file is a good place to start. It offers blazing fast performance utilizing multicore processing, and requires zero configuration.Ĭreate a package.json file in your project directory using: yarn init -y You will get a default tsconfig.Parcel is a web application bundler, differentiated by its developer experience. If you are creating a new project from scratch and require a tsconfig.json file, the boilerplate can easily be booted up by going to File > New > tsconfig.json File. When you start WebStorm, you will have the option of choosing an empty project or a boilerplate setup for the most popular JavaScript libraries and frameworks such as Angular, Cordova, Express, Meteor, Node.js, React, React Native, and Vue.js. This is because WebStorm comes with built-in project templates that you can use as you start. When it comes to TypeScript with WebStorm, you don’t have to do much. Here is a quick guide on how to run TypeScript in WebStorm and develop your first app to get you started. tsx files with code support systems to make your workflow as seamless as possible.įor JavaScript developers, especially those working with Angular, TypeScript support in an IDE can make or break the productivity glass ceiling. One of the main features of WebStorm is its support for TypeScript source code. This specialized tool focuses on JavaScript development and features an extensive suite of built-in developer tools, fast navigation, search, customizable environments, and real-time teamwork integrations. WebStorm is part of JetBrains’ suite of language-specific IDEs. But is it? And what exactly can WebStorm do for you? WebStorm is a JetBrains IDE that prides itself on being the “smartest JavaScript IDE” on the market.
0 Comments
Leave a Reply. |
AuthorWrite something about yourself. No need to be fancy, just an overview. ArchivesCategories |